Company Description Kewanna Screen Printing Inc provides durable, weather-resistant decals, labels, tags, collars, and vehicle graphics to a wide range of industries. The company combines traditional screen printing with modern digital printing to efficiently handle both large and small orders. Through its websites, including KSPprints.com and halfwraps.com, KSP offers cost-effective stock products as well as custom solutions for small businesses and larger clients. Customers can browse product selections online and access easy-to-follow installation resources, allowing many projects to be completed without outside sign shops. KSP emphasizes value, durability, and customer support via its website, phone, email, and professional networks.

Role Description This is a full-time, on-site Screen Printing Press Operator role based in Kewanna, IN. The Screen Printing Press Operator will set up, operate, and monitor screen printing presses to produce decals, labels, tags, and related products according to job specifications and quality standards. Daily tasks include preparing screens, inks, and materials; aligning and registering artwork; performing test prints; and adjusting press settings to ensure accurate color and print quality. The role also involves inspecting finished products, troubleshooting minor mechanical or print issues, maintaining a clean and safe work area, and performing routine equipment maintenance. The operator will work closely with production and design teams to meet deadlines, manage multiple jobs in the queue, and support continuous improvement in efficiency and quality.

Qualifications

  • Hands-on skills in Print Production and Printing, with the ability to set up, run, and monitor presses safely and efficiently.
  • Proficiency in Screen Printing processes, including screen preparation, ink mixing, registration, and quality control.
  • Experience or familiarity with Embroidery or other decoration methods is a plus for supporting broader production needs.
  • Basic understanding of Print Design principles to interpret artwork specifications, layouts, and color requirements.
  • Strong attention to detail, including accurate measurement, color matching, and inspection of finished products.
  • Ability to lift and move materials, stand for extended periods, and safely operate production equipment.
  • Effective communication skills and the ability to follow written instructions, job tickets, and safety procedures.
  • Prior experience in a print shop, manufacturing, or similar production environment preferred; on-the-job training may be provided.
  • Reliable attendance, punctuality, and the ability to work both independently and as part of a production team.
